Step 3 – Make Your First Bitcoin Deposit
With verification out of the way, you’re ready to fund your wallet. Go to the cashier or deposit page and select bitcoin as your payment method. The casino will generate a unique BTC wallet address for you. Copy this address carefully—any extra characters or a missing digit will send the funds to the wrong place. Open your personal bitcoin wallet (hardware, mobile, or desktop) and paste the address as the destination.
Enter the amount you wish to deposit, bearing in mind any minimum deposit limits stated on the site. Confirm the transaction and wait for the required number of network confirmations, typically one to three. Step 6 – Manage Your Bankroll Wisely
Effective bankroll management is the cornerstone of long‑term success. Decide on a maximum amount you’re comfortable losing in a single session, and stick to it. A common rule is to wager no more than 1‑2 % of your total bankroll on any one spin or hand. This approach reduces the risk of rapid depletion and gives you more playing time.
If you experience a winning streak, resist the temptation to chase higher bets immediately. Instead, lock in a portion of your profit and continue playing with a modest stake.
Common Pitfall: Chasing losses by increasing bet sizes dramatically. This often leads to a swift drop in balance and diminishes the enjoyment of the game.
